Our associates have been using "forensics know how" since 1988.  We have assisted companies and legal counsel for the past decade and a half in establishing the origins of pollution.  We have used a variety of methods including isotopic tracers, computer models, soil and groundwater chemistry, and a variety of other fingerprinting methods.  The Dragun Corporation's associates are also asked to teach forensics courses and have done so in several different countries including The United States, Japan, Kuwait, The United Kingdom, and Italy.
